ALEXANDRIA, Va., Dec. 2 -- United States Patent no. 12,489,623, issued on Dec. 2, was assigned to MESINJA PTY LTD (Camberwell, Australia).
"Systems and computer-implemented methods for generating pseudo random numbers" was invented by Robert Bede Shorten (Camberwell, Australia).
